AI-Generated Summary

The Atlanta Hawks are on the verge of securing a playoff berth, sitting 11 games above .500 and poised to clinch the 5th seed with just one more win. Hosts Jackson and Logan celebrate the team’s remarkable turnaround since trading Trae Young, highlighting a 12-game win streak and a dominant stretch where they’ve won 18 of their last 20 games. The Hawks’ recent 46-point lead over the Brooklyn Nets in the first half exemplifies their current dominance, though the hosts note the team’s offensive struggles against weak opponents. They praise Nikhil Alexander-Walker’s emergence as a nightly scorer and Dyson Daniels’ pivotal role, likening him to the sun—essential to the team’s identity. Despite injuries like Jock Landale’s, the Hawks remain confident in their depth, especially with Mo Bamba and Christian Koloco stepping in. The hosts also debate playoff matchups, favoring the Knicks over the Cavs due to better offensive matchups and psychological appeal. Looking ahead, they discuss the draft, with Keaton Wagler and LeBaron Phylon emerging as top targets at #7, while expressing skepticism about high-upside guards like Darius Acuff. The episode closes with a mix of triumph and cautious optimism, as the Hawks aim to finish strong and avoid relying on outside help.
